В начало

Перенос документа НачисленияРаботникам из 8.2 в 8.3

           

Есть некий документ «Начисления сотрудникам», который нужно перенести из базы-источника (Обычные формы) в базу-приемник (Управляемые формы).

Рис. Документ «Начисления работникам» в базе-источнике

 

            Итак, запускам базу источник в пользовательском режиме, выгружаем структуру метаданных с помощью обработки «MD82Exp.epf».

Рис. Выгрузка структуры метаданных базы-источника

 

            Потом запускаем базу приемник и также выгружаем структуру метаданных. Но уже при помощи обработки «MD83Exp.epf».

Рис. Выгрузка структуры метаданных базы-приемника

 

            Потом открываем конфигурацию «Конвертация данных», обновляем структуры метаданных для базы-источника и базы-приемника.

Рис. Обновление структуры метаданных базы-приемника

 

            Далее создаем новое правило обмена для документа начисление работникам.

Рис. Правило обмена «НачислениеРаботникам»

 

            Заметим, что в базе-источнике документ называется «Начисление работникам», а в базе-приемнике тот же документ называется «Начисление сотрудникам», сопоставляем эти два справочника.

            Кроме того, для вида начислений нужно также создать правило, поскольку в базе-источнике виды начислений помещены в перечисления, а базе-приемнике размещены в справочнике.

Рис. Правило конвертации объектов «ВидыНачислений», закладка внизу «Конвертация значений»

 

            Значения для правила «ВидыНачислений» необходимо сопоставить на закладке в нижней части экрана «Конвертация значений». Здесь каждому значению перечисления «ВидыНачислений» из базы-источника присвоено предопределенное значение из справочника «ВидыНачислений» из базы-приемника.

            Далее переходим на вкладку «Правила выгрузки» и создаем правило «НачисленияРаботникам», после чего сохраняем правила.

Рис. Правило выгрузки данных «НачисленияРаботникам»

Рис. Сохранение правил обмена в файл «ПРАВИЛА.xml»

 

            Затем переходим в базу-источник и выгружаем данные с помощью обработки «Универсальный обмен данными…», она же «V8Exchan82.epf».

Рис. Выгрузка данных для документа «НачислениеРаботникам» из базы-источника

 

            Потом переходим в базу-приемник, запускаем обработку «Универсальный обмен данными…», файл «MD83Exp.epf» и загружаем данные.

Рис. Загрузка данных через обработку «Универсальный обмен данными…» в базу-приемник

 

            Обращаем внимание на служебные сообщения, а именно сколько объектов ушло/выгрузили и сколько объектов пришло/загрузили.

            Далее ищем документ в базе-приемнике и визуально проверяем, перенесенную нами информацию на корректность.

Рис. Документ «Начисления сотрудникам» в базе-приемнике

(реквизит документа «Размер начисления» не показан, не влез в рисунок)

 

            Реквизиты (дата документа, номер, вид начисления) документов «Начисления сотрудникам» соответствуют исходному документу в базе-приемнике, а значит задача поставленная задача выполнена.